By Amal Al Riyami — NIZWA: Dec 21: A scout camp for students was organised by Al Mozn Basic Education School in the Wilayat of Nizwa in Al Dakhiliyah. It was held at Al Nojoom playground. A total of 70 boys and girls from Al Mozn School and four other schools — Shoulat Al Alam School, Madinat Al Alam School, Falaj Daris School and Ruboua Al Jabal School – participated in the camp. The camp began with the installation of tents. Students learnt how to pitch tents in a proper manner. They learned about pottery and tried their hand at making some utensils with clay.


They learnt how to use a fire extinguisher. They learnt about the importance of health and nutrition, and the food they should eat to develop immunity from diseases. Participants also learned how to use a rope and types of knots. Khadija al Subaihi, scout activity supervisor at Al Mozn School, said: “Scouting helps children love adventure and succeed in life. When large groups of boys or girls of similar age have a common goal, be it sports or community service, they learn valuable team skills.” Al Subaihi said teamwork, leadership, perseverance and good communication will help children succeed in life. “We are trying to instill these qualities in them.”
